Nissan unveils "all-new" Townstar to replace existing LCV line-up

Nissan Townstar is a new addition to electric LCV's.

Nissan released its newest electric van, the Townstar to replace e-NV200 in its European commercial vehicles line-up.

The Townstar has several new features compared to the e-NV200, starting with the battery. A 44 kWh battery generates 122 hp, 245 Nm of torque and a range of 285 kilometres. Townstar will have a maximum 22 kW charge speed capability, reaching 80% charge in 42 minutes. 

Townstar will come with ProPilot Assist, an advanced driver assistance system to keep the van centred in a lane during driving. One of 20 technical features of the Townstar is Trailer Sway Control. 

Other important safety features include the Intelligent Emergency Braking for the fully electric version of Townstar. The refined gasoline version of Townstar features Intelligent Cruise Control.  

Drivers will access Apple CarPlay and Android Auto on an 8-inch touchscreen and will have wireless phone charging. 

The design reflects the lines of Ariya 

Townstar has 3.9 square metre cargo space, which can carry two Euro pallets and an additional 800 kg. The LCV’s towing capacity is 1,500 kg. Large sliding doors in the cargo area and 180 degree opening rear doors ease cargo loading and unloading.
